<script>
(function(window) {
'use strict';
// Tags identifying ChangeMessages that move change into WIP state.
const WIP_TAGS = [
'autogenerated:gerrit:newWipPatchSet',
'autogenerated:gerrit:setWorkInProgress',
];
// Tags identifying ChangeMessages that move change out of WIP state.
const READY_TAGS = [
'autogenerated:gerrit:setReadyForReview',
];
/** @polymerBehavior Gerrit.PatchSetBehavior */
const PatchSetBehavior = {
/**
* Given an object of revisions, get a particular revision based on patch
* num.
*
* @param {Object} revisions The object of revisions given by the API
* @param {number|string} patchNum The number index of the revision
* @return {Object} The correspondent revision obj from {revisions}
*/
getRevisionByPatchNum(revisions, patchNum) {
patchNum = parseInt(patchNum, 10);
for (const rev in revisions) {
if (revisions.hasOwnProperty(rev) &&
revisions[rev]._number === patchNum) {
return revisions[rev];
}
}
},
/**
* Construct a chronological list of patch sets derived from change details.
* Each element of this list is an object with the following properties:
*
* * num {number} The number identifying the patch set
* * desc {!string} Optional patch set description
* * wip {boolean} If true, this patch set was never subject to review.
*
* The wip property is determined by the change's current work_in_progress
* property and its log of change messages.
*
* @param {Object} change The change details
* @return {Array<Object>} Sorted list of patch set objects, as described
* above
*/
computeAllPatchSets(change) {
if (!change) { return []; }
const patchNums = [];
for (const commit in change.revisions) {
if (change.revisions.hasOwnProperty(commit)) {
patchNums.push({
num: change.revisions[commit]._number,
desc: change.revisions[commit].description,
});
}
}
patchNums.sort((a, b) => { return a.num - b.num; });
return this._computeWipForPatchSets(change, patchNums);
},
/**
* Populate the wip properties of the given list of patch sets.
*
* @param {Object} change The change details
* @param {Array<Object>} patchNums Sorted list of patch set objects, as
* generated by computeAllPatchSets
* @return {Array<Object>} The given list of patch set objects, with the
* wip property set on each of them
*/
_computeWipForPatchSets(change, patchNums) {
if (!change.messages || !change.messages.length) {
return patchNums;
}
const psWip = {};
let wip = change.work_in_progress;
for (let i = 0; i < change.messages.length; i++) {
const msg = change.messages[i];
if (WIP_TAGS.includes(msg.tag)) {
wip = true;
} else if (READY_TAGS.includes(msg.tag)) {
wip = false;
}
if (psWip[msg._revision_number] !== false) {
psWip[msg._revision_number] = wip;
}
}
for (let i = 0; i < patchNums.length; i++) {
patchNums[i].wip = psWip[patchNums[i].num];
}
return patchNums;
},
computeLatestPatchNum(allPatchSets) {
if (!allPatchSets || !allPatchSets.length) { return undefined; }
return allPatchSets[allPatchSets.length - 1].num;
},
/**
* Check whether there is no newer patch than the latest patch that was
* available when this change was loaded.
* @return {Promise} A promise that yields true if the latest patch has been
* loaded, and false if a newer patch has been uploaded in the meantime.
*/
fetchIsLatestKnown(change, restAPI) {
const knownLatest = this.computeLatestPatchNum(
this.computeAllPatchSets(change));
return restAPI.getChangeDetail(change._number)
.then(detail => {
const actualLatest = this.computeLatestPatchNum(
this.computeAllPatchSets(detail));
return actualLatest <= knownLatest;
});
},
};
window.Gerrit = window.Gerrit || {};
window.Gerrit.PatchSetBehavior = PatchSetBehavior;
})(window);
</script>
